In this insightful episode of the Grow Business Podcast, hosts Cory Mosley and Lon Graham tackle the challenges of cost-cutting while maintaining business growth and stability.
They discuss the risks of slashing marketing budgets, laying off key employees, and delaying technology upgrades—all of which can have long-term negative impacts.
The conversation also explores how a business’s physical appearance affects customer perception, using real-world examples like a run-down Wendy’s to highlight the importance of timely renovations.
Cory and Lon share practical strategies for smart cost-cutting, such as eliminating unnecessary expenses, leveraging automation, renegotiating vendor contracts, optimizing space, and refining product offerings to focus on what drives profitability.
They wrap up with actionable insights to help business owners make strategic spending decisions that support long-term success, even in uncertain economic conditions.
Main Takeaways:
- Cutting marketing and sales budgets can stifle business growth—invest wisely instead.
- Laying off key employees can lead to a loss of expertise and operational inefficiencies.
- A neglected physical appearance can harm customer perception and revenue.
- Smart cost-cutting involves eliminating wasteful spending while investing in high-ROI strategies.
- Regular cost audits help businesses align expenses with growth goals.
